The COVID Super Booster Vaccine is reportedly set to give a green light to millions of British people from the fall.

Jab, specially designed to protect against Omicron strains, is expected to be replenished in over 30 million people in their 50s.

Moderna’s so-called super boosters are claimed to be five times better than the original vaccine and are expected to move forward from drug regulators within a few weeks, Mail on Sunday reports. ..

Informally named 214, it uses mRNA molecules to program the immune system and protect it from the original Wuhan strain and two types of Covid, Omicron.

Last week, the level of infection jumped to almost one-third, and the Omicron case reoccurred.

However, it remains below the March peak.

Last Friday, the influential European Medicines Agency (EMA) said it believed that Moderna’s new vaccine “may offer some benefits to broadening the immune response” to recipients. ..

And it said, “The bivalent vaccine … may be considered for use as a booster.”

Meanwhile, the company is said to have already talked with the UK Health Director about putting 214 jabs on the plate.

Dr. Paul Burton, Modena’s Chief Medical Officer, said he had a “clear interest” in buying a new vaccine from the UK, Telegraph reports.

Last month, Moderna released positive results showing that the so-called Superjab provided strong protection against the two subvariants that are driving the current wave of infection, Omicron BA4 and BA5.

Dr. Burton said: “The conclusion is that the increase at 214 could be a turning point in the fight against the SARS-Cov-2 virus.”

This happens after the survivors of the Omicron Covid Wave have been warned that they cannot dodge new strains of circulating bugs.

According to a study by Imperial College London, those who have had a previous Omicron disease should catch it again, including old BA.1 and BA.2 versions, new BA.4 and BA.5 strains, etc. Was not immune.

It is despite the fact that they have boosted immunity to previous strains such as Delta and Alpha.
